Along with elbows, carbon steel pipe fittings additionally include tees, which link 3 areas of pipe, producing joints for liquid circulation. Equal tees are made use of when the attaching branches are of the very same size, while reducing tees are utilized when the branch pipe is of a smaller diameter. Past tees and elbows, the realm of flanges merits state. Flanges, including types such as SO flanges (Slip-On), WN flanges (Weld Neck), and BL flanges (Blind), function as vital components in piping systems. Carbon steel flanges are specifically popular as a result of their stamina and cost-effectiveness. The selection of flange kind should line up effortlessly with the intended application and liquid buildings, making sure a secure and watertight joint.
